Clinical Research and Drug Trials

Our physicians offer clinical studies to children, as a means of treatment that would not normally be available to them. Participation is voluntary, and we have strict rules of privacy.

Clinical studies test new drugs or drug combinations to treat disorders or disease. Before their use, these new drugs are studied at length in the lab. Also, all federally regulated clinical studies are approved by the Institutional Review Board (IRB).

We are currently enrolling volunteers with diagnosis for studies, including:

  • Migraines (abortive and preventive)
  • Epilepsy
  • Tourette syndrome
  • Chronic motor tic
  • Vocal tic
  • A.D.H.D.

     
 
CenterforNeurosciencesResearch

    Our team is dedicated to finding cures for pediatric neurological diseases. In 2012, we launched the Children’s Center for Neurosciences Research in collaboration with Emory University, Georgia Institute of Technology and the Morehouse School of Medicine. Learn more.
